My problem with M&M VI is how ridiculous the dungeons are in the later parts of the game. Alamos, Darkmoor, Gharik's forge, and the Tomb of VARN are all examples of massive sprawling hulks that are too big. (and that is also why I can't play Daggerfall without some measure of frustration. But that is not a Might and Magic game so I'll leave it at that.)
This was fixed in M&M VII but then the inverse was true in M&M VIII with its one room dungeons.

I think part of the reason why the dungeons were so rediculous later on is because of Lloyd's Beacon. Using that spell, you can constantly be +30 level, +50 stats and instant heal whenever you want. Then, combine that with shooting out loads of Shrapmetal right in the opponent's faces, and yeah.. they pretty much had to make those dungeons rediculous to keep the game challenging.

So.. Town Portal is okay, but Lloyd's Beacon is gamebreaking.
